Update: Missing Palo Alto Woman Found Safe

Naomi Brown, who has dementia, was found in good condition.

Update: 7 p.m.:  Police in Redwood City located an 85-year-old Palo Alto woman who was reported early Saturday morning from an assisted living center. 
--

The Palo Alto Police Department seeks the public’s help to locate a missing at-risk elderly woman.

Naomi Brown, a white 85-year-old female who suffers from dementia, left Lytton Gardens at 649 University Ave. around 10:45 a.m.

She’s described as being about 5 feet tall and 170 pounds. Brown last wore a white jacket with black embroidery, dark pants and a multi-color hat with silk flowers on it. She uses a walker and carried green colored cloth bag with her. 

If asked, Brown might say that she’s from Half Moon Bay or that she’s on her way there.
